Fruity Pebble Bark

This playful and colorful bark combines the creamy texture of white chocolate with the crunch of Fruity Pebbles cereal, making it an enjoyable treat perfect for sharing.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Dessert, Snack
Cuisine American
Servings 12 pieces
Calories 150 kcal

Ingredients
  

Chocolate Base

  • 8 ounces good quality white chocolate, chopped or chips This gives a clean, creamy base.
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il or light corn syrup Helps a glossy, spreadable sheen.
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, at room temperature Adds richness without overpowering.
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ract Adds a soft background note.
  • 1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t Brightens the sweetness without making it salty.

Cereal and Extras

  • 2 cups Fruity Pebbles cereal, packed lightly Adds crisp color and crunch.
  • 1/4 cup mini marshmallows or candy pieces Optional for chew and visual interest.
  • Flaky sea salt, for sprinkling Optional for a tiny pop of contrast.

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Line a baking sheet with parchment and set it on the counter.
  • Melt the white chocolate in a heatproof bowl set over simmering water, stirring gently until smooth and glossy. Stop heating once no lumps remain.
  • Stir in the vegetable oil, butter, and vanilla until the mixture looks silky and pours easily.
  • Add the fine sea salt and taste a small amount on a spoon to ensure the flavor is balanced.

Mixing

  • Fold in the Fruity Pebbles in two additions, using a wide spatula to keep the pieces intact.
  • Work quickly so the cereal stays crisp and retains color.
  • Stop folding once the cereal is evenly coated and still has light air pockets.

Setting

  • Pour the mixture onto the prepared sheet and spread it to about 1/4-inch thickness.
  • Drop a few extra cereal clusters on top and press gently while the chocolate is still warm.
  • Scatter optional mini marshmallows or candy pieces across the top and press them in lightly.
  • Let the bark cool at room temperature until fully set, at least one hour, or expedite in the fridge for 20 to 30 minutes.

Serving

  • Once set, remove from the paper and break into irregular pieces with your hands.
  • Serve immediately or store in an airtight container.

Notes

Store pieces in an airtight container at cool room temperature for up to five days. For longer storage, freeze pieces between parchment layers in a sealed bag for up to one month.
